##
O que é site estático Um site estático é uma coleção de arquivos estáticos que o navegador do usuário busca logo no início do processo de carregamento do site. Ao contrário dos sites dinâmicos que são gerados dinamicamente cada vez que um usuário os visita, as páginas estáticas são apenas uma agregação de HTML, imagens, estilos, scripts e outros arquivos.
Estrutura de um site estático
Para manter tudo bem organizado, é recomendável dividir o site nos seguintes diretórios e arquivos:
1. index.html: Esta é a página inicial do seu site e geralmente é o primeiro arquivo que os usuários verão quando acessarem o seu site. Deve conter a estrutura básica e o conteúdo do seu site, incluindo cabeçalho, menu de navegação, área de conteúdo principal e rodapé.
2. Pasta CSS: Esta pasta armazenará as folhas de estilo do seu site que regem a aparência do seu site, como fonte, cores, layout e muito mais.
3. Pasta de imagens: Esta pasta conterá todas as imagens utilizadas no seu site, como logotipos, ilustrações e fotos.
4. Pasta de scripts: Esta pasta conterá todos os arquivos JavaScript que você usa para recursos interativos e efeitos dinâmicos em seu site.
5. Favicon.ico: Este pequeno arquivo é responsável pela pequena imagem que aparece na guia do seu navegador, nos seus favoritos e em outros lugares.
6. Arquivo Robots.txt: Este arquivo de texto controla o rastreamento e a indexação do seu site pelos mecanismos de pesquisa.
7. Arquivo .htaccess: Este arquivo de configuração opcional é usado para configurações avançadas, como redirecionamento de URLs, configuração de proteção por senha e muito mais.
Como criar um site estático
A criação de um site estático envolve construir a estrutura e o conteúdo do site usando HTML, CSS e JavaScript e hospedá-lo em um servidor web. Aqui está um resumo básico das etapas que você pode seguir:
1. Planeje seu site: Defina a finalidade, estrutura e conteúdo do seu site. Desenhe um mapa do site para visualizar como as páginas serão interligadas.
2. Crie os arquivos HTML: Escreva o código HTML para cada página do seu site, incluindo as seções de cabeçalho, navegação, conteúdo principal e rodapé.
3. Projete com CSS: Crie folhas de estilo CSS para definir a aparência e o layout do seu site, como fontes, cores e posicionamento.
4. Adicione funcionalidade com JavaScript: Use JavaScript para quaisquer elementos interativos, como menus, formulários, animações e muito mais.
5. Otimizar imagens: Comprima e otimize imagens para reduzir o tamanho do arquivo sem comprometer a qualidade visual.
6. Teste seu site: Teste exaustivamente seu site em vários navegadores e dispositivos para garantir que funcione conforme planejado.
7. Escolha um provedor de hospedagem na web: Selecione um provedor de hospedagem na web que ofereça suporte para sites estáticos.
8. Implante seu site: Faça upload dos arquivos e pastas do seu site para o provedor de hospedagem escolhido.
9. Promova seu site: Assim que seu site estiver no ar, comercialize e promova-o para aumentar sua visibilidade e atrair visitantes.